Solve the problem.The figure shows two intersections, labeled A and B, that involve one-way streets. The numbers and variables represent the average traffic flow rates measured in vehicles per hour. For example, an average of 600 vehicles per hour enter intersection A from the west, whereas 250 vehicles per hour enter this intersection from the north. A stoplight will control the unknown traffic flow denoted by the variables x and y. Use the fact that the number of vehicles entering an intersection must equal the number leaving to determine x and y.

A. x= 250, y = 150
B. x= 600, y = 500
C. x= 400, y = 450
D. x= 450, y = 400


Answer: C
